Distribution, ecology and conservation status of Dionysia involucrata Zaprjag., an endangered endemic of Hissar Mts (Tajikistan, Middle Asia)
2014
<em>Dionysia involucrata</em> Zaprjag. (Primulaceae) is known as critically endangered endemic species of Hissar Mountains in Tajikistan. It is reported from few localities mainly in Varzob River valley and its tributaries. The species inhabits steep or overhanging faces of granite rocks in narrow river gorges. During the research all known populations of <em>D. involucrata</em> were examined in respect of the habitat conditions and species composition of vegetation plots. Validation of chasmophytic syntaxa of colline and montane zones in Tajikistan (Middle Asia)
2016
AbstractEight syntaxa are validated with the previous names regarded as invalidly published according to the International Code of Phytosociological Nomenclature. The validation concerns syntaxa of rock plant communities of the Campanuletalia incanescentis order reported from the Pamir Alai mountains in Tajikistan. The majority of validated syntaxa represents association level, one is an alliance. All validations are conducted due to the invalidity of tables with typus releves according to art. 1 of the Code: they were not distributed as printed matter. Healthy Aging and Sentence Production: Disrupted Lexical Access in the Context of Intact Syntactic Planning.
2020
AbstractHealthy ageing does not affect all features of language processing equally. In this study, we investigated the effects of ageing on different processes involved in fluent sentence production, a complex task that requires the successful execution and coordination of multiple processes. In Experiment 1, we investigated age-related effects on the speed of syntax selection using a syntactic priming paradigm. Both young and older adults produced target sentences quicker following syntactically related primes compared to unrelated primes, indicating that syntactic facilitation effects are preserved with age. Effects of Selective Attention on Syntax Processing in Music and Language
2010
Abstract The present study investigated the effects of auditory selective attention on the processing of syntactic information in music and speech using event-related potentials. Spoken sentences or musical chord sequences were either presented in isolation, or simultaneously. When presented simultaneously, participants had to focus their attention either on speech, or on music. Final words of sentences and final harmonies of chord sequences were syntactically either correct or incorrect. Irregular chords elicited an early right anterior negativity (ERAN), whose amplitude was decreased when music was simultaneously presented with speech, compared to when only music was presented.
